The wireless phase dimming load controller is a compact, reliable solution for both manual and automatic lighting control, linking seamlessly to remote occupancy sensors, photocells, and companion switches without the need for low voltage wiring. With no minimum load requirements, this dimmer is suitable for even the smallest lighting zones. Measuring less than one inch deep, the unit is significantly shallower than typical dimmers, resulting in less crowded wall boxes and faster, more convenient installation. For small spaces, such as private offices, a wireless phase dimmer controller linked to a single wireless ceiling sensor (e.g., SWX-221-B) provides efficient control. Both occupancy (auto-on) and vacancy (manual-on) operation are supported to meet energy code requirements, making it ideal for spaces like small offices, copy rooms, or private restrooms. In medium-sized spaces, such as conference rooms or small classrooms, a wireless phase dimmer controller linked to a single wireless wide view sensor (e.g., SWX-421-B) ensures comprehensive coverage. Additional sensors can be linked as needed, and dimming or switching from a second location, such as a 3-way setup, can be achieved by linking a remote wireless wall switch (either line-powered SWX-854-2 or battery-powered SWX-854-B) to the wireless phase dimming load controller.
The controller supports a variety of electrical loads, including LED, CFL, ELV, and incandescent lighting. It offers selectable reverse (default) and forward phase dimming within the same unit, relay-based switching with no minimum load requirements, and 3-way plus dimming when wirelessly linked with remote dimming stations. Overload protection monitors and safeguards the unit from overheating, while non-volatile memory retains all settings even in the event of power loss.
Physically, the enclosure is 25-40% shallower than other wall dimmers, with a depth of less than one inch into the wall box. The controller presents a modern aesthetic with individual easy-tap buttons for on, off, raise, and lower, matching the styling of other wall devices. Additional features include a self-grounding mounting strap and a blue locator LED that is visible when lights are off. The unit links in seconds with wireless sensors and remote wall stations, supporting up to 30 wireless devices. Configurable parameters include high/low trims, turn-on levels, dimming curve types, time delays, operational modes, daylight harvesting, and photocell functionality. A white LED indicator changes intensity as the dim level is adjusted.
Electrical specifications include 120VAC, single-phase operation at 50/60 Hz. Maximum load ratings are 375W for LED/ELV and incandescent/halogen in reverse phase mode and 150W for CFL/LED in forward phase mode, with factory consultation required for MLV ratings. The controller accommodates a variety of load types, including LED drivers, fluorescent ballasts, ELV, incandescent, halogen, and MLV. It has been tested for ESD and surge immunity without damage or memory loss.
The physical size of the unit is 2.74 inches high by 1.68 inches wide by 1.39 inches deep (6.96 x 4.27 x 3.53 cm), weighing 4.5 ounces, and mounts in a single gang switch box. The LED status indicator is bi-color white and blue. Operational modes include occupancy and vacancy, partial on/off, daylight harvesting, and on/off/inhibit photocell, with configurable time delay options of 1, 5, 10, 15, 20, or 30 minutes.
Wireless communication is provided via a 915 MHz ISM band, with a range of 80 feet line of sight and 40 feet with obstructions. Wireless linking is achieved with a simple three-second push-button process, and all data is encrypted for security. The environmental range for full-load operation is 32°F to 86°F (0°C to 30°C), with relative humidity of 0-95% non-condensing for indoor use only.
